Top 5 Squad RPG Apps on Android in Ireland Q3 2021
In Q3 2021, the top Squad RPG apps on Android in Ireland showcased varying tr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Here's a closer look at their performance.
The third quarter of 2021 saw interesting trends in the performance of the top 5 Squad RPG applications on the Android platform in Ireland. Here's a detailed look at the we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ends for these popular apps.
Looney Tunes™ World of Mayhem experienced a notable increase in weekly downloads, starting from around 83 in late June and peaking at 1.2K in early August before gradually declining to 194 by the end of September. Weekly revenue showed fluctuating growth, reaching its peak at approximately $226 in early August. Active users followed a similar upward trend, peaking at around 1.2K in mid-August before a gradual decrease to 612 by the end of September.
Gacha Club maintained a steady download rate throughout Q3, starting at 552 in late June and ending at 299 in late September. Weekly active users remained relatively stable, hovering around 8K throughout the quarter.
CookieRun: Kingdom saw a significant rise in weekly downloads, starting at 62 in late June and reaching 1.3K by the end of September. Revenue for the app showed a substantial increase, peaking at approximately $2.1K in the last week of September. Active users mirrored this growth, starting at 796 in late June and rising to nearly 3.8K by the end of the quarter.
RAID: Shadow Legends displayed consistent performance with weekly revenue peaking at around $6.6K in the final week of September. Downloads remained stable, ranging between 234 and 626 throughout the quarter. Active users saw a slight fluctuation, peaking at 1.5K in late July and ending the quarter at 1.1K.
Pokémon Quest showed a steady decline in weekly downloads, starting at 388 in late June and dropping to 239 by the end of September. Revenue peaked at $72 in late August, while active users gradually decreased from 883 in late June to 708 by the end of the quarter.
